Ezekiel 19:10-12
International Children’s Bible
10 “‘Your mother was like a vine in your vineyard.
It was planted beside the water.
The vine had many branches and gave much fruit
because there was plenty of water.
11 The vine had strong branches.
They were good enough for a king’s scepter.
The vine became tall
among the thick branches.
And it was seen because it was tall
with many branches.
12 But it was pulled up by its roots in anger.
It was thrown down to the ground.
The east wind dried it up.
Its fruit was torn off.
Its strong branches were broken off.
They were burned up.
Ezekiel 19:10-12
New International Version
10 “‘Your mother was like a vine in your vineyard[a](A)
planted by the water;(B)
it was fruitful and full of branches
because of abundant water.(C)
11 Its branches were strong,
fit for a ruler’s scepter.
It towered high
above the thick foliage,
conspicuous for its height
and for its many branches.(D)
12 But it was uprooted(E) in fury
and thrown to the ground.
The east wind(F) made it shrivel,
it was stripped of its fruit;
its strong branches withered
and fire consumed them.(G)
Footnotes
- Ezekiel 19:10 Two Hebrew manuscripts; most Hebrew manuscripts your blood
